What are GLP-1 medications?

GLP-1 stands for glucagon-like peptide-1, a hormone your body already makes. GLP-1 medications, including semaglutide and tirzepatide, mimic this hormone. They help regulate appetite, slow how quickly your stomach empties, and support healthy blood sugar levels. In practice, most patients simply describe feeling full sooner and thinking about food less.

Originally developed for type 2 diabetes, several GLP-1 medications are now FDA-approved for chronic weight management when prescribed by a licensed provider.

Who may qualify?

GLP-1 therapy is not for everyone, and it's not a shortcut. In general, providers consider it for adults who have:

  • A BMI in the obesity range, or
  • A BMI in the overweight range along with a weight-related condition such as high blood pressure, high cholesterol or prediabetes

Your medical history matters too. Certain conditions and medications mean GLP-1s aren't a safe fit, which is exactly why the decision belongs in a consultation with a physician, not a checkout page. What about side effects?

Honesty matters here. The most common side effects are digestive: nausea, constipation or an upset stomach, especially in the early weeks as your dose is gradually increased. Most patients find these manageable and temporary, but this is another reason ongoing medical supervision is important. Your provider adjusts your plan based on how your body responds.

A word of caution about buying GLP-1s online

Demand for these medications has created a wave of unregulated sellers offering "no consultation needed" products. Skipping the medical evaluation isn't a convenience, it's a risk. You deserve to know that your medication is legitimate, your dose is right for you, and someone qualified is monitoring how you respond. Always get GLP-1 therapy through a licensed medical provider.
